The global market for Resistance-type Oil Lubrication Systems represents a stable and growing sector within the broader industrial automation and maintenance ecosystem. Valued at an estimated US$316 million in 2024, the market is on a path of steady expansion, forecast to reach a readjusted size of US$390 million by 2031. This growth, characterized by a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 3.1% during the forecast period 2025-2031, reflects sustained demand across traditional and emerging industrial applications. Operating on a low-pressure principle, it utilizes precisely calibrated restrictors—the "resistance" elements—within its distribution lines to meter small, consistent volumes of oil to numerous lubrication points. This Technology Evolution makes it an ideal, economical solution for light-to-medium duty machinery operating at moderate speeds, particularly where many lubrication points are grouped closely together. Its hallmark is a simple, robust structure offering controllable flow rates and high operational reliability, which explains its entrenched position in sectors demanding continuous, dependable operation. The Competitive Landscape is shaped by established global leaders and specialized manufacturers. Key players driving innovation and supply include SKF, Bijur Delimon International, Lincoln Industrial, Graco, and Groeneveld. These companies provide the core components—distributors, pumps, valves, and control systems—that form the backbone of these lubrication solutions. The market is strategically segmented, revealing distinct application focuses: By Type: Systems are categorized as Fixed Resistance, Intermittent Resistance, or Continuous Resistance, each suited to different operational rhythms and oil delivery requirements. By Application: Dominant Downstream Applications are Machine Tools, Textile Machinery, Automobile Manufacturing, and Heavy Equipment (including mining and construction machinery). These sectors rely heavily on the precise, reliable lubrication that resistance-type systems deliver to protect costly capital assets. Supply Chain Structure and Industry Profitability Analysis The upstream supply chain is mature, comprising lubricants, precision distributors, check valves, pumps, and sensors. Downstream, the Market Trends show concentrated demand in metallurgy, mining, machine tools, and increasingly, in renewable energy sectors like wind power. The industry operates with a defined production and margin structure. A single production line typically has an annual capacity of around 3,000 units, with highly automated facilities achieving up to 6,000 units. Industry Profitability, as measured by gross margin, generally ranges between 22% and 30%. International integrated system brands can command margins near 35%, while domestic medium-sized manufacturers typically operate within an 18% to 25% range, reflecting the balance between brand value, technology, and competitive pricing. Future Trajectory: Navigating Challenges and Capitalizing on Mega-Trends The Industry Outlook for resistance-type systems is being reshaped by several powerful Market Trends. The Shift to Intelligence and IoT Integration: The most significant Technology Evolution is the integration of these mechanical systems with Programmable Logic Controllers (PLCs) and Industrial IoT (IIoT) platforms. This enables remote monitoring, data-driven oil quantity adjustment, and predictive fault warnings, transforming lubrication from a routine maintenance task into a strategic, data-informed component of smart manufacturing. Key Growth Drivers: Major opportunities stem from the global push for smart manufacturing upgrades, policies promoting domestic equipment substitution in key economies, and burgeoning demand from expanding sectors like wind power and rail transit, where equipment reliability is paramount. Persistent Challenges and Barriers: The Industry Development Status also faces hurdles. These include the high precision manufacturing required for core components (valves, pumps), which impacts cost and quality control. Furthermore, extended system design cycles for custom projects and a lingering gap in user awareness regarding the full benefits of intelligent lubrication systems present obstacles to faster adoption. Intense price competition and rising demand for customized solutions also pressure manufacturers, particularly small and medium-sized enterprises, to balance cost-effectiveness with technical service capabilities.
